Title:
VERTICAL ACCELERATION TIME-OF-FLIGHT TYPE MASS SPECTROGRAPH
Document Type and Number:
Japanese Patent JP3746629
Kind Code:
B2
Abstract:

PROBLEM TO BE SOLVED: To provide an ion extraction electrode in which a contour line showing intensity distribution of an electric field is not distorted even when the ion extraction electrode having specified thickness is used in the end of a mesh, and ions can be accelerated in the perpendicular direction to the ion introduction direction in the vicinity of the ion extraction electrode similarly to the vicinity of the mesh.
SOLUTION: In a vertical acceleration time-of-flight type mass spectrograph having a vertical acceleration region comprising an ion pushing-out electrode 9 and an ion extraction electrode facing each other, a means 17 giving an intermediate potential between the potential of the ion extraction electrode and that of the ion pushing-out electrode is installed on the circumfeential wall surface in a vertical acceleration region, and potential distribution between the ion pushing-out electrode and the ion extraction electrode is corrected.
